Academic Training for Boys from Idaho
We have qualified teachers on staff who offer instruction and one-on-one tutoring attention to the students. At Master’s Ranch, we accomplish both ends of the academic spectrum. The flexible curriculum allows students who may be having difficulty with certain courses to accomplish them and catch up. Advanced coursework and college-prep programs are ready for those who succeed academically and desire to get ahead.
Our boarding school operates year-round, to keep students engaged and to give them the opportunity to catch up or retake courses and improve their grade point average. During normal summer break we run a half-day academic regimen to allow time for projects, sports and recreation.

Troubled Boys from Idaho Learn from Vocational Training
Boys who have improved their actions and have become trustworthy are given a chance for work experience in the local economy. It allows them to exercise their new coping skills and to earn money to help them once they leave the ranch. The wage they earn is put into an account that they withdraw when they leave. The ranch itself also offers some vocational opportunities for the young men to learn from, including handling the cattle, construction, pedigree dog breeding, and farming. The boys gain marketable skills and self-confidence from these endeavors.

Idaho is the 14th most extensive, the 39th most populous, and the 7th least densely populated of the 50 United States. The state’s largest city and capital is Boise. Residents are called “Idahoans”. Idaho was admitted to the Union on July 3, 1890, as the 43rd state. |
